您现在的位置是: 首页 - PLC - 系统之心微型编码的艺术与智慧 PLC

系统之心微型编码的艺术与智慧

2024-06-26 PLC 1人已围观

简介一、系统之心:微型编码的艺术与智慧 二、嵌入式系统开发流程概述 在当今科技迅速发展的背景下,嵌入式系统已成为现代生活中不可或缺的一部分。从智能手机到汽车电子设备,从医疗监控到工业控制,几乎所有高科技产品都依赖于这些小巧而强大的计算机系统。在设计和实现这样的复杂技术时,我们需要遵循一个严谨且详细的开发流程。 三、需求分析与定义 首先,在进行嵌入式系统开发之前,我们需要对目标设备进行深入分析

一、系统之心:微型编码的艺术与智慧

二、嵌入式系统开发流程概述

在当今科技迅速发展的背景下,嵌入式系统已成为现代生活中不可或缺的一部分。从智能手机到汽车电子设备,从医疗监控到工业控制,几乎所有高科技产品都依赖于这些小巧而强大的计算机系统。在设计和实现这样的复杂技术时,我们需要遵循一个严谨且详细的开发流程。

三、需求分析与定义

首先,在进行嵌入式系统开发之前,我们需要对目标设备进行深入分析,以确保我们的设计能够满足用户和市场的需求。这个阶段涉及到对项目范围、性能要求、兼容性问题以及可能遇到的挑战等方面的详尽评估。通过这种方式,我们可以为后续工作奠定坚实基础,同时减少未来的修改成本。

四、硬件选择与设计

随着需求分析后的确定,接下来是硬件选择与设计。这一步骤包括选取合适的处理器架构、内存大小、高度可靠性和低功耗电源管理方案,以及考虑传感器和外设连接等关键组成部分。这里我们必须权衡成本效益,并确保所选硬件能提供足够高效率以支持应用程序。

五、软件框架搭建

在完成硬件配置后,我们进入软件框架搭建阶段。这包括操作系统选择(如RTOS)、驱动程序编写以及应用层逻辑实现。这个过程中需关注代码优化以最大限度地利用资源,同时保证稳定性和可扩展性。此外,对于安全性的考量也是非常重要,因为嵌入式设备往往处于开放环境,有潜在风险遭受攻击。

六、二次开发与集成测试

一旦软件框架搭建完成,就开始进行二次开发,即根据实际应用场景调整算法逻辑并添加特定的功能模块。此时还需结合实际情况对整个系统进行综合调试,以确保各个组成部分协同无误。一系列严格的测试环节将保证最终产品达到预期性能标准,这些测试可能包括单元测试、小规模集成测试、大规模集成测试以及用户接受度评价等多个层面。

七、生产准备与质量控制

经过充分验证后,便进入生产准备阶段。这意味着所有必要材料已经就绪,制造工艺也得到了精细规划。在此期间,还要实施严格的质量控制措施来避免生产过程中的失误或不合格品出现。为了提高效率和降低成本,可以采用自动化工具,如PCB自动焊接机或者SMT贴片机来辅助生产过程。

八、高级功能部署与维护服务

最后,不仅要将产品推向市场,更要为其提供持续更新升级服务。而这通常涉及到远程升级功能甚至是基于云端的大数据收集分析能力,为客户带来更丰富更便捷的地理信息服务。在使用过程中,由专业团队负责解决用户反馈的问题,并不断改进产品,使其符合不断变化的人类需求,是保持竞争力的关键因素之一。

九、本文总结:

本文通过探讨从需求分析到维护服务这一完整流程,让读者了解了如何有效地应对嵌入式系统工程师面临的一系列挑战。本文对于每个步骤都给予了深刻解析,从而帮助理解不同环节间相互作用如何影响最终结果,为那些渴望掌握这一领域知识的人提供了一份宝贵指南。

标签: 工控机和plc的区别工控PLC